Mafia (2002) is a fighting, shooter, racing, adventure video game developed by Illusion Softworks, available on XBOX, PC, PS2. It holds an aggregated critic and player score of 74/100 on IGDB.

What is Mafia about?

Mafia is a 3D action crime epic set in the seedy underworld of the 1930's. Rise from the lowly but well-dressed Footsoldier, to an envied and feared Made Man in an era of mob hits, car chases, and bootlegging. Earn a reputation as a tough enforcer, daring getaway driver, and deadly hitman in your quest for respect and power within the Salieri Family.

Key details

Mafia was released in 2002 and supports single player. Platforms: XBOX, PC, PS2. Developer: Illusion Softworks.
